QUESTION

When a parent identifies specific person to adopt child and is no longer able how do you revoke adoption

Asked on Jan 26th, 2013 on Family Law - New Jersey
More details to this question:
Child adopted via identified surrender of parental rights by paternal grandparents. Both grandparents are physically mentally and financially unfit to continue to care for child. How do rights get put back into play

You would have to go back to court and DYFS involved to see if the concerns you have are justified.  You will need to bring an action claiming that the paternal grandparents are unfit, and list the specific allegations against them.
